源码centos cmake3 linux

17 Linux 中断实验

一、Linux 中断简介 1. Linux 中断 API 函数 ① 中断号 每个中断都有一个中断号,通过中断号可以区分出不同的中断。在 Linux 内核中使用一个 int 变量表示中断号。 ② request_irq 函数 在 Linux 中想要使用某个中断是需要申请的,request_irq 函数 ......
Linux 17

CentOS7 安装 phpMyAdmin

1. MySQL 和 phpMyAdmin MySQL是一个在各类开发者之上流行的数据库! 它是开源的,在速度和功能之间保持着完美的平衡。 这就是为什么在本教程中,我们将向您展示如何在 CentOS 7 上安装 phpMyAdmin——一个用于 MySQL 数据库管理的神奇工具。 使用 phpMyA ......
phpMyAdmin CentOS7 CentOS

如何使用 Windows 远程控制一台正在运行的 Linux 系统。

什么是 OpenSSH OpenSSH 是一款用于远程登录的连接工具,它使用 SSH 协议 1。SSH 协议可以用来进行远程控制或在计算机之间传送文件,比传统的方式更安全 2。Windows 系统默认安装了 OpenSSH Client,可以直接使用,Linux 服务器一般也都默认安装了 OpenS ......
远程控制 正在 Windows 系统 Linux

Centos6、Kylin3.2 升级glibc2.17方法

一、下载安装包 wget http://copr-be.cloud.fedoraproject.org/results/mosquito/myrepo-el6/epel-6-x86_64/glibc-2.17-55.fc20/glibc-2.17-55.el6.x86_64.rpmwget http ......
Centos6 方法 Centos Kylin3 glibc2

Linux串口ttyUSB修改别名

Linux环境下经常会遇到USB设备节点不固定的问题,每次重启系统都会打乱当前连接设备的设备节点,本文主要介绍如何通过修改设备节点别名的方式来识别设备。 ......
串口 别名 ttyUSB Linux

linux udp raw socket

tcp/udp网络通信与socket实际上是两个概念,不过因为我们平常使用tcp/udp,不可避免的使用socket,所以认为两者是同一个事物。 我们现在所说的或者最常用到的都是BSD版本的socket。socket是对tcp/udp等网络协议的封装,提供上层接口,供我们使用,可以编写程序在网络间传 ......
socket linux udp raw

Studio 3T 2023.6 (macOS, Linux, Windows) - MongoDB 的专业 GUI、IDE 和 客户端,支持集成 ChatGPT

Studio 3T 2023.6 (macOS, Linux, Windows) - MongoDB 的专业 GUI、IDE 和 客户端,支持集成 ChatGPT The professional GUI, IDE and client for MongoDB 请访问原文链接:,查看最新版。原创作品 ......
客户端 ChatGPT MongoDB Windows 客户

Nginx安装——Centos

yum安装 官网 nginx: Linux packages 安装必备组件: sudo yum install yum-utils 创建指定目录文件 vim /etc/yum.repos.d/nginx.repo #将官网内容复制到文件中 [nginx-stable] name=nginx stab ......
Centos Nginx

【Linux】环境变量查看、设置 环境变量 的3中方法

环境变量 在Linux中,环境变量是一种全局变量,用于存储系统级别的配置信息,可以在操作系统中的各个进程之间共享。环境变量包含了一些重要的配置信息,例如系统路径、默认编辑器、语言设置等。 每个环境变量都有一个名称和一个对应的值。当一个进程启动时,它会继承当前的环境变量,并且可以读取和修改这些变量的值 ......
变量 环境 方法 Linux

linux centos7 开启tomcat不成功

在bin文件夹下打开终端,输入./start.sh后报错权限不够 解决方法: 依旧在终端上输入chmod +x *.sh(网上说输入chmod +x startup.sh也可以,但我没成功) 输入ll可看到*.sh的文件都高亮 此时再次输入./startup.sh即可成功 ......
centos7 centos tomcat linux

Thread中join方法源码阅读

以JDK11为例,共3个join方法 一、核心join方法 public final synchronized void join(long millis) throws InterruptedException { long base = System.currentTimeMillis(); l ......
源码 方法 Thread join

linux 基本使用、新建用户、emqtt 的基本使用

## 连接云服务器 #### 推荐软件 1. putty 2. xshell [点击下载](https://www.jb51.net/softs/595174.html) 3. windows10 cmd 命令行自带的 ssh ## linux 基本命令: **按下按键 tab 可以自动补全文件名/ ......
用户 linux emqtt

【Linux】设置文件权限指令:sudo chmod -R 755 ~

linux 命令chmod 755 含义解析 chmod 是Linux下设置文件权限的命令,后面的数字表示不同用户或用户组的权限。 一般是三个数字:第一个数字表示文件所有者的权限第二个数字表示与文件所有者同属一个用户组的其他用户的权限第三个数字表示其它用户组的权限。 权限分为三种: 读(r=4),写 ......
指令 权限 文件 Linux chmod

Linux查看系统文件打开数

参数配置: https://blog.csdn.net/hjh872505574/article/details/129688548 1、查看系统限制用户的最大文件打开数 ulimit -n 2、查看当前打开的文件数lsof -Ki|wc -l 如果不加参数:lsof |wc -l,统计的是进程的线 ......
文件 系统 Linux

Linux iptables 防火墙常用规则

iptables 安装 yum install iptables iptables 规则清除 iptables -F iptables -X iptables -Z 开放指定的端口 允许本地回环接口(即运行本机访问本机) iptables -A INPUT -s 127.0.0.1 -d 127.0 ......
防火墙 iptables 规则 常用 Linux

Linux系统中多种方法解决wget command not found问题

解决问题的方法: 检查wget是否安装: 首先,我们需要确认是否在系统上安装了wget。执行以下命令检查: which wget 如果安装了wget,则会显示该命令的路径(例如:/usr/bin/wget)。如果没有安装,你将看到空白输出或没有输出。 安装wget: 如果系统中没有wget,我们可以 ......
多种 command 方法 问题 系统

Linux部署Consul单机和集群

Linux部署Consul单机和集群 一、Consul简介 Consul是由HashiCorp基于Go语言开发的支持多数据中心的分布式高可用服务发布和注册软件, 采用Raft算法保持服务的一致性, 且支持健康检查,Consul和Eureka的侵入式服务中心不同的是, Consul是以独立的软件形式运 ......
集群 单机 Consul Linux

磁盘为标准分区的linux云主机如何正确进行系统扩容

问题现象 云主机上根盘容量太小计划给根盘扩容,在云平台上点击系统扩容后进入云主机发现挂载点容量大小没变化,如何正确的给文件系统格式为xfs的根盘扩容呢? 如图1,当前云主机根盘大小只有100G,需要扩容到200G,需要如何操作? (图1 云主机根盘大小情况) 原因分析 云平台上点击系统扩容后,实际上 ......
磁盘 主机 标准 系统 linux

磁盘为lvm分区类型的linux云主机,如何正确进行系统扩容

问题现象 lvm分区类型的云主机系统空间不足,如何进行扩容,如下图,根分区为lvm类型,分区大小只有39G,如何正确进行扩容。 (图1 查看系统分区情况) 原因分析 云主机系统空间不足,需要对根盘进行扩容 解决方案 1.云平台上扩容成功后,进入云主机系统,使用lsblk查看可以发现系统盘vda已经扩 ......
磁盘 主机 类型 系统 linux

[内核源码] epoll 实现原理

https://wenfh2020.com/2020/04/23/epoll-code/ 文章主要对 tcp 通信进行 epoll 源码走读。 Linux 源码:Linux 5.7 版本。epoll 核心源码:eventpoll.h / eventpoll.c。 搭建 epoll 内核调试环境视频: ......
内核 源码 原理 epoll

linux之grep的整理

因为芯片前端涉及到很多脚本的使用,目的是调用脚本对文本的操作。常用的脚本文件有makefile, perl, tcl, python. 而了解到grep是一个linux下强大的文本搜索工具。这个命令能帮我们按照正则表达式搜索文本,然后打印出来。 ## 命令格式 ``` grep "match_pat ......
linux grep

Linux安装ErLang语言(图文教程详细版)

一,博主环境:CentOS7第一步:wget https://packages.erlang-solutions.com/erlang-solutions-1.0-1.noarch.rpm 第二步:yum -y install epel-release 第三步:rpm -Uvh erlang-sol ......
语言 图文 教程 ErLang Linux

如何通过外网访问内网 linux 系统

可以在linux上安装配置cpolar内网穿透,映射22端口,生成公网地址,实现在外网ssh远程访问内网linux cpolar支持http/https/tcp协议,不限制流量,不需要公网IP,还支持永久免费使用 1:免费注册cpolar账号 2:安装cpolar curl -L https://w ......
系统 linux

linux udp socket

# 服务端源码 ``` #include #include #include #include #include #include #define BUFF_SIZE 1024 int main() { int sock = 0; int recvlen = 0; // 接收数据缓冲区 char b ......
socket linux udp

linux服务器TCP端口连接状态统计netstat命令

一、查看哪些IP连接本机 netstat -an 二、查看TCP连接数 1)统计80端口连接数 netstat -nat | grep -i "80" | wc -l 2)统计httpd协议连接数 ps -ef | grep httpd | wc -l 3)统计已连接上的,状态为“establish ......
端口 命令 状态 netstat 服务器

linux 搭建基于AWS S3协议的存储服务

Minio 提供对象存储服务,兼容了 AWS S3 存储协议,用于非结构化的数据存。非结构化对象,比如图像,音、视频,日志文件,备份镜像…等等管理不方便,不定长,大小变化大、类型多,云端的访问复杂,minio就是来解决这种场景的。非结构化的文件从数KB到5TB都能很好的支持。开源并且用Go语言开发, ......
linux AWS

CTFHUB-Web进阶-Linux

动态加载器 参考资料: https://www.wolai.com/ctfhub/4YqbrWboUwvdxqXmPHW9EQ https://zhuanlan.zhihu.com/p/235551437 ![images](https://img2023.cnblogs.com/blog/1845 ......
CTFHUB-Web CTFHUB Linux Web

flask之cbv源码分析,模板,请求与响应,session和源码分析,闪现,请求扩展

[toc] ## 1 cbv分析 ```python # 基于类的视图,写法 from flask import Flask,request from flask.views import View, MethodView app = Flask(__name__) app.debug = True ......
源码 模板 session flask cbv

直播程序源码OAuth协议:开放授权的重要性

在直播程序源码平台,需要OAuth协议这样的协议,OAuth协议保证了用户在使用直播程源码平台结合第三方应用程序的技术功能时的安全性与方便性,也为直播程序源码平台的用户提供了许多互动功能,是让直播程源码平台成为更高质量、更好的平台。 ......
程序源码 重要性 源码 程序 OAuth

9k+ Star 简洁好用的开源 Linux 运维管理面板

运维管理面板通过可视化界面和直观的键鼠操作取代了繁琐的命令行操作,让服务器运维管理步骤更简单,并且降低了操作的门槛,是一款实用的软件工具。 ......
面板 Linux Star 9k